Transaction 2014dd86a6f538bf247eb874bae3bfd52c342367dde2ecf9bcfa754758032a51
1 Input
1 Output
-
2014dd86a6f538bf247eb874bae3bfd52c342367dde2ecf9bcfa754758032a51:0
- value
- 27211118
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bba9ccbb0b49375008efcc0c4b1a8bd1708a82ca OP_EQUALVERIFY OP_CHECKSIG
- address
- 1J7GmmL67ak8KZ2Z9B9N1wXUdrJH9U72Ds